This past June, we had the opportunity to collaborate with Isaac Chan, a graduated senior of Newport High School, to host a formal dinner/dance event for the members of Seattle Union Gospel Mission's Hope Place shelter. The Hope Place branch works to rehabilitate women and children who have been victims of domestic abuse. Isaac wanted to create this event to not only restore a sense of dignity to the homeless of Seattle, but also establish a community awareness and responsibility to high school students. Now that Isaac has graduated, he has passed on his work to us, Alex Namba, Victoria Gu and Daniel Koh. We would like to continue Isaac's spirit of giving back and host another 'Promless for Hope Place' event this December. While last years event was prom-themed, this year we are aiming for a 'home for the holidays' theme. The funds raised through Gofundme.com will be used to purchase food/supplies and decorations. All leftover money will go directly to the Seattle Union Gospel Mission for their use. We will be collecting all our funds at the beginning of December in prep for the event. This means a lot to us as we have witnessed the effect that Issac had on our community and we would like to give back just as he had. Our goal is to create an event that is unforgettable for the women and children of Hope Place.
